If you cannot find the SW800 towers (5 10" drivers per speaker) you may be able to find the smaller SW800's (I think these had two of the same 10" SEAS per speaker). The key is getting the SW800C crossover which has software specific to the CLS. The Kinergetics system is the *only* sub system specifically designed for the CLS. The ML Decent and Depth subs are designed for later models (way different animals than the CLS) and really are appropriate for HT use, (even the guys at ML will tell you so).

Contrary to the usual approach of crossing over as low as possible, the Kinregetics/CLS combination is best crossing at 110htz with the 17db Butterworth high & low passes. Using tubes on the panels and ss on the subs sounds best to me. BTW, Tony DiChiro claims that the SW800's, due to their physical configuration and the crossover circuitry, approximated a line source down to 200 cycles when tested. In any event, the mini-Statement confirguration is the best I have heard with the CLS. I'd rather listen sans subs, which while different is quite good, if the SW800's are not an option. So, maybe looking for the smaller SW800's (with stands) is worth a try provided you get the dedicated crossover. The Genesis towers may the best option if you decide to "wing it". Good luck.
